A stunning book to treasure - By: Dr. H. Payne, 02 Jun 2006
What an amazing, beautiful book. Every page has elaborately crafted pop-ups that compliment the well-known poem. Before I showed it to my son I must have spent an hour going back & forth through the pages enjoying the scenes for myself.

An earlier reviewer said that it was a book unsuitable for young children. I would say that it very much depends on the childin question. My 2 year old was thrilled by the book. It was intended for use only over the Christmas period, to be put away & stored until the following festive season. I think we actually managed to put it awayin March, not because he tired of it but after repeated discussions about Christmas being over.

Not only did my little boy love the book, but he did not damage it. The book IS delicate & is not for unsupervised use by small children. But if children have reasonable language skills & can be trusted to do what they are told they can enjoy looking at the pictures & listening to the poem while an adult holds the book & turns the pages.

After buying this book I ordered several more copies as gifts for friends' children next Christmas as well as several other books by this unusally talented man.
Not suitable for under 5s - By: Mrs Judith M Duck, 20 Oct 2005
I have just returned this book as the pop ups were too scary for my children. Purchasers should note that they are mainly white, elaborate paper cut outs. It definitely did not appeal to my two (5 & 2). The pop ups are very detailed (and therefore subject to potential immediate distruction by anyone aged under 3) but notin the least bit traditional. If you have pre-schoolers my recommendation would be to steer clear of this version of this book. It may appeal to adults/older children, but our family were very disappointed.
